Below is an essay outline and key themes for a high-quality analysis of Taxi Driver , which is a frequent subject for film studies.

Essay Title: The Mirror of Urban Decay: Isolation in Scorsese’s Taxi Driver 1. Introduction : Introduce the gritty, neon-soaked 1970s New York City.

: Travis Bickle’s descent into violence is not just a personal breakdown but a reflection of a "morally bankrupt cityscape" and the profound isolation of modern urban life.

: Mention the film's historical importance as a "New Hollywood" classic. 2. The Theme of Alienation and Loneliness The "Metal Coffin"

: Discuss how Travis’s taxi acts as a barrier between himself and the world, turning him into a "passive observer" of a society he views with disdain. Social Failure

: Analyze his failed attempt to connect with Betsy, which highlights his inability to understand social norms or the reality of the people around him. 3. Cinematography and Realism vs. Expressionism Visual Style

: Describe how Scorsese uses disorienting angles, street lights, and slow-motion tracking shots to reflect Travis’s inner turmoil and "fragmented psyche". The Male Gaze The Digital Drop-Off: Why "Movies4u

: Apply film theory (like Laura Mulvey’s "Male Gaze") to discuss how Travis tries to exert power in a world where he feels he has none. 4. The Moral Complexity of the Anti-Hero Hero or Villain?

: Discuss the ending—where Travis is hailed as a hero despite his violent rampage. This "moral decay" of society suggests that the world he lives in is just as broken as he is. 5. Conclusion

: Reiterate how the film remains relevant as a study of loneliness and societal neglect. Final Thought : Conclude that Taxi Driver

is less about a man driving a cab and more about a man "perpetually engaged in a journey" for purpose in a world that ignores him. Tips for Writing a Film Essay

2. Legal Liability

While streaming (not downloading) occupies a gray area in some jurisdictions like the United States, it is still illegal in many European and Asian countries. ISPs (Internet Service Providers) track visits to domains like movies4u.taxi. You may receive warning letters, throttled speeds, or, in severe cases, fines.
